What will I learn?

Dis Advisor in Family an' Social Economics Trainin' gi yuh practical tools fi check household money matters, map out income an' expenses, an' mek realistic budgets an' stabilization plans. Yuh wi learn fi spot priority problems, ease debt stress, link families wid benefits an' community services, an' use ethical, culturally sensitive, autonomy-respectin' guidance fi support lastin', confident money management.

Develop skills

  • Ethical advisin' in family finance: apply confidentiality an' cultural humility.
  • Quick family financial check: map income, debts, an' support networks.
  • Practical budgetin' an' debt plans: build cash-flow, sort bills, an' negotiate.
  • Benefits an' service navigation: find, check, an' explain local aid options.
  • Behavior-change sessions: set goals, coach habits, an' track progress.
